  • Belvoir Pet Hospital Veterinarian in South Euclid, OH | Belvoir Pet HospitalBelvoir Pet Hospital was built as a veterinary clinic in 1938 by Dr. David Elsasser. He and his family lived on the second floor of the hospital and raised their three daughters there. Marty and Joe Farkas purchased Belvoir Pet Hospital in the late 1960’s, and their son, Butch, joined them in practice in 1998. Marty passed away in 2004, and Joe continued practicing with Butch until his retirement in 2010. We are proud to be an independently owned and operated veterinary practice.
